Default an afternoon 11r hand

moved to the table towards end of rebuy and I've paid zero attention because I'm at a FT for a small 100 PL stars tourn with colson. So player reads are lacking, at best.

My thought process is he's not calling a raise on the flop without a set, given how deep we are I'd like to let him fire again on the turn. Given the turn card now I figure it's way ahead way behind and proceed accordingly. Look good?
